Welcome to ShieldMail. We are committed to protecting your privacy and giving you control over your personal information. This Privacy Policy explains our practices regarding data collection, usage, and protection when you use our browser extension.
ShieldMail is built on a privacy-first philosophy. Unlike many online services, we have designed our extension to operate with zero data collection from our end. This means we do not collect, store, analyze, or share any information about you or your usage of the extension.

ShieldMail is designed for general audiences and does not knowingly collect information from children under 13 years of age. Given that we don't collect any personal information from any users, this protection extends to all age groups.
If you are a parent or guardian and believe your child is using ShieldMail, please note that no personal information is being collected or stored on our servers.
